The recent transformation of Nejire's character in the anime has stirred up lively discussions among fans. Following a drastic haircut, many are noticing significant changes in her personality and screen presence. This change marks a shift that could redefine her role in the series.
Before she cut her hair, Nejire mainly had limited screentime and was characterized by her bubbly personality. Fans recall fewer bold moments, noting her cheerful demeanor dominated her early appearances. However, post-haircut, thereโs been a noticeable shift. Enthusiastic responses from people highlight how she appears fierce and determined. A user summed it up:
"After the haircut, sheโs fierce, with epic attacks and a backstory reveal!"
Many fans agree that her short hair isn't just stylish; it signifies a transformation. Commenters on various forums echoed similar sentiments, suggesting that her personality feels more serious now. One fan stated, "Maybe this is why I prefer her short hair."
Interestingly, the haircut came after a traumatic event where Dabi severely burned her hair. This backstory adds depth, leading fans to scrutinize her newfound fierceness.
"She was burned, the anime just censored her injuries," pointed out a commentator, indicating that these events shaped her evolution.
The visual change has also sparked debates on aesthetic appeal. Some fans believe that while the short hairstyle gives her a more youthful and approachable look, the long hair presents a femme fatale vibe. One comment summarized this contrast:
"It's the difference between cute and sexy."
This division showcases varying fan perspectives on character design and personality development through simplistic changes in appearance.
